The market value of Virtus InfraCap Preferred is measured differently than its book value, which is the value of Virtus that is recorded on the company's balance sheet. Investors also form their own opinion of Virtus InfraCap's value that differs from its market value or its book value, called intrinsic value, which is Virtus InfraCap's true underlying value. Investors use various methods to calculate intrinsic value and buy a stock when its market value falls below its intrinsic value. Because Virtus InfraCap's market value can be influenced by many factors that don't directly affect Virtus InfraCap's underlying business (such as a pandemic or basic market pessimism), market value can vary widely from intrinsic value.
Please note, there is a significant difference between Virtus InfraCap's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if Virtus InfraCap is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. However, Virtus InfraCap's price is the amount at which it trades on the open market and represents the number that a seller and buyer find agreeable to each party.

Virtus InfraCap Preferred Backtested Returns

Virtus InfraCap Preferred owns Efficiency Ratio (i.e., Sharpe Ratio) of -0.025, which indicates the etf had a -0.025% return per unit of risk over the last 3 months. Virtus InfraCap Preferred exposes twenty-nine different technical indicators, which can help you to evaluate volatility embedded in its price movement. Please validate Virtus InfraCap's Coefficient Of Variation of 1771.76, semi deviation of 0.4837, and Risk Adjusted Performance of 0.0331 to confirm the risk estimate we provide. The entity has a beta of 0.44, which indicates possible diversification benefits within a given portfolio. As returns on the market increase, Virtus InfraCap's returns are expected to increase less than the market. However, during the bear market, the loss of holding Virtus InfraCap is expected to be smaller as well.

Autocorrelation, which is Virtus InfraCap etf's lagged correlation, explains the relationship between observations of its time series of returns over different periods of time. The observations are said to be independent if autocorrelation is zero. Autocorrelation is calculated as a function of mean and variance and can have practical application in predicting Virtus InfraCap's etf expected returns. We can calculate the autocorrelation of Virtus InfraCap returns to help us make a trade decision. For example, suppose you find that Virtus InfraCap has exhibited high autocorrelation historically, and you observe that the etf is moving up for the past few days. In that case, you can expect the price movement to match the lagging time series.
